devoid of
Definitions
Entirely lacking or free from.
Empty or destitute of a specified quality or substance.
Examples
The abandoned house was completely devoid of any signs of life.
His speech was entirely devoid of emotion, leaving the audience feeling disconnected.
Synonyms
lacking destitute of void of empty of bereft of deficient in barren of
Antonyms
full of teeming with abounding in replete with fraught with brimming with filled with
